Cooker hood panel unresponsive, activates on its own during the day
Issue
- The control panel does not respond to touch
- Control panel self-activation in daytime
- Cannot switch on the light or change the cooker hood speed
Applies to
- Cooker Hoods with "Touch on steel" feature
Resolution
Recalibrate the control panel.
CAUTION!
For correct calibration, touch the full surface of the sensor by the finger.
1. Make sure that the appliance is connected to the electrical supply.
2. Touch any sensor 10 times. You will hear a beep after each touch.
3. The control panel will enter calibration mode.
All sensors will start to blink, and the
(Timer icon) sensor will turn on.
4. Touch the
(Timer icon) sensor and keep your finger on it for 2 seconds. After 2 seconds, it will turn off, and the next sensor will turn on.
5. Touch each sensor when it turns on in the following order:
6. When you touch the last sensor, the calibration is complete.
Cause
- The control panel can be affected by environmental conditions (direct sunlight, other source that generates an infrared beam)
